人事工资管理系统的设计与实现.docx

上传人:b****3 文档编号:2788950 上传时间:2022-11-15 格式:DOCX 页数:27 大小:40.71KB
下载 相关 举报
人事工资管理系统的设计与实现.docx_第1页
第1页 / 共27页
人事工资管理系统的设计与实现.docx_第2页
第2页 / 共27页
人事工资管理系统的设计与实现.docx_第3页
第3页 / 共27页
人事工资管理系统的设计与实现.docx_第4页
第4页 / 共27页
人事工资管理系统的设计与实现.docx_第5页
第5页 / 共27页
点击查看更多>>
下载资源
资源描述

人事工资管理系统的设计与实现.docx

《人事工资管理系统的设计与实现.docx》由会员分享,可在线阅读,更多相关《人事工资管理系统的设计与实现.docx(27页珍藏版)》请在冰豆网上搜索。

人事工资管理系统的设计与实现.docx

人事工资管理系统的设计与实现

吉林大学珠海学院

毕业论文(设计)

人事工资管理系统的设计与实现

TheDesignandImplementationofPersonnelSalaryManagementSystem

完成日期2013年1月25日

吉林大学珠海学院本科毕业论文(设计)开题报告

人事工资管理系统的设计与实现

摘要

工资管理是公司管理的一个重要内容。

随着企业人员数量增加,企业的工资管理工作也变得越来越复杂。

工资管理既涉及到企业劳动人事的管理,同时也涉及到企业财务的管理。

早期的工资统计和发放都是使用人工方法处理纸质材料的方式,不仅花费财务人员大量的时间且不易保存,往往由于人为的因素例如抄写不慎或计算疏忽,出现工资发放错误的现象[1]。

工资管理系统使用电脑安全保存、快速计算、全面统计,实现了工资管理的系统化、模块化、自动化[1]。

工资管理系统前台程序开发工具采用微软的VisualBasic6.0,后台数据库采用ACCESS2000。

VisualBasic6.0是一种面向对象的开发工具,具有组件丰富、语言简单、功能强大的优点。

ACCESS数据库具有与VisualBasic6.0无缝连接、操作简单、易于使用的优点。

工资管理系统具有数据输入,数据存储,档案录入,档案查询,工资查询等功能。

关键词:

工资管理;毕业设计;VB编程

TheDesignandImplementationofPersonnel

SalaryManagementSystem

Abstract

The salarymanagementasanimportantpartofthecompany'smanagementbecomesmoreandmorecomplicatedwiththeincreasingnumberoftheemployees.Thesalarymanagementinvolveslabourandpersonnelmanagement,aswellasthefinancialmanagementofenterprise.Earlystatisticsandpayoffofthesalaryiscompletedbythemanualmethodusingtraditionalpapermaterials,whichnotonlywastesmassivetimeoffinancialstaff,butalsoisdifficulttosave.Themistakesofpayoffsometimesshowupduetosomehumanfactorssuchascarelesscopyingandcount.

Thesalarymanagementsystemusingcomputertosavefilessecurely,calculaterapidlyanddocompletestatisticscanrealizethesystematization,modularizationandautomationofthewagemanagement.ThesalarymanagementsystemusestheVisualBasic6.0asthedevelopmenttoolofforegroundprogram,andtheACCESS2000asthetoolofdevelopingbackgrounddatabase.VisualBasic6.0isakindofobject-orienteddevelopmenttools,whichhastheadvantageofabundantcomponentsandsimplelanguage,andACCESSdatabasewiththeadvantageofseamlessconnectionwithVisualBasic6.0andsimplicityofoperatoriswieldytooperators.

?

?

?

?

Thesalarymanagementsystemhasthefunctionofdatainput,datastorage,filesinput,filesqueryandwagesquery,which improvestheworkefficiency,savesthemanuallabourandmaterialresources.

Keywords:

Salarymanagement;Graduationdesign;VBprogramming

1绪论………………………1

1.1问题的提出………………………1

1.2解决的方法………………………1

1.3管理信息系统概述………………………2

1.3.1管理信息系统的发展………………………2

1.3.2管理信息系统的特点………………………3

1.3.2.1管理信息系统的组成要素………………………3

1.3.2.2………………………管理信息系统(MIS)的界面特点3

1.4VisualBasic6.0………………………5

2人事管理系统分析与设计………………………9

2.1人事管理系统功能分析………………………9

2.2人事管理系统模块设计………………………10

2.2.1人事档案管理………………………11

2.2.2业务档案………………………12

2.2.3工资管理………………………12

2.2.4考勤管理………………………13

2.2.5系统管理………………………14

2.3数据库设计………………………14

2.3.1数据库概念结构设计………………………15

2.3.2数据库的逻辑结构设计………………………15

2.3.3数据库结构的实现………………………19

3人事管理系统的功能实现………………………20

3.1开发环境简介………………………20

3.2系统界面的设计………………………21

3.3员工基本信息录入窗体的设计………………………22

3.4员工基本信息维护窗体的设计………………………24

3.5员工业务界面设计………………………24

3.6创建考勤表………………………25

3.7考勤表的维护………………………26

3.8员工工资表窗体的设计………………………27

4总结………………………29

参考文献………………………30

致谢………………………31

1绪论

1.1问题的提出

我所实习的公司成立于2011年,最初为一家规模小,员工人数不多的企业。

随着这两年公司的规模壮大,部分人事也初步运用了计算机进行管理,如员工的基本信息、员工的考勤信息,和工资信息等,但这些管理是分割开的,没有统一管理,各种信息之间没有通过计算机将信息之间逻辑联系,大部分日常事务还仅仅依靠手工方法来管理信息数据,以至于出现了差错频繁、人员冗杂、效率低下的情况。

为了提高办事效率,公司也有意开发相关软件进行辅助管理。

随着公司逐年的发展,公司的人事工资事务大体包括以下几个方面的内容:

人事基本信息管理,员工的业务档案管理、员工的工作评价管理、员工的考勤管理、员工的工资管理等[14]。

若采取人工方法来处理这些数据,在人力、物力、财力方面上会严重造成浪费,并且进行统计和分析是非常不易的,由于要处理的信息量过大[14]。

有的公司往往利用计算机软件excel进行公资管理,但是公司同时希望能够把各种的人事信息,考勤信息,工作评价信息,工资信息等进行统一管理[14]。

所以设计出良好的工资管理系统,不但能促进员工自身素质的不断提高而且为管理也提供了有效的数据信息。

1.2解决的方法

由于计算机科学技术的飞速发展和不断提高,计算机科学技术日渐趋于成熟,并且计算机其强大的功能已被广大人民所深刻理解和认识,计算机在人们的生产和生活的各个领域中扮演着相当重要的位置。

作为计算机应用的一部分,应用计算机对公司日常人事工资进行管理,具有手工管理所无法匹敌的优点。

比如说:

成本低、可靠性高、寿命长、存储量大、查找方便、检索迅速等优点,从而能大大的提高管理和办事的效率,因此,开发这样一款软件是一件很有必要的事情。

而且只要软件的设计合理,就可以为公司节约资源,减少错误的发生,利用计算机的高速运算及大容量存储,运行速度快的优点,借助数据库管理技术,开发一个公司人事工资系统,实现公司人事工资管理规范化、自动化。

人事工资管理唯有具有人性化管理、自动化、高效率等优点才能满足企业员工队伍的

需求,人事工资管理期望以最快的速度将人事工资信息做最适当的运用。

如下面几项:

(1)以自动化、系统化、高效管理代替分散、重复操作

(2) 开发人事工资信息管理系统,进一步提高单位效益和现代化信息管理水平。

(3) 建立企事业人事工资信息管理系统,提高员工的自律性,促进员工人才的成长和流动。

(4)减轻人事工资管理员的负担,节省人力物力开支。

1.3管理信息系统概述

1.3.1管理信息系统的发展

第一阶段是统计系统,它是管理信息系统的最初级阶段,它是通过把数据分成两组即较不相关的组和较相关的组,数据间表面的规律是它研究的主要内容,然后是通过把数据转换为信息[2]。

第二阶段是数据更新系统,例如:

美国航空公司是其典型的代表,该公司所研发出来了SABRE预约订票系统,在20世纪50年代时,这个预约订票系统总共设有1008个订票点,其中可以存取共600000个旅客记录与27000个飞行段记录,但是其操作比较复杂,在何地用户都可以利用这个系统查出来某一架航班座位的剩余情况。

但从大概上来说,这个系统仅仅是一个数据更新系统,比方说这个系统不能明确的显示以现在的售票速度票将何时售完的情况,从而可以采取相应的补救措施。

所以说这个系统也是管理信息系统(MIS)的低级阶段[2]。

第三阶段是状态报告系统,这个阶段是由生产状态报告、研究状态报告和服务状态报告等系统组成的。

例如生产状态报告系统来说,这一系统代表是IBM公司所生产的管理系统。

正如大家所知,在世界上,IBM公司是最大的计算机公司,在1964年,IBM公司所生产的中型计算机IBM360这一产品,使计算机水平提高到了另一个层次上,与此同时组织管理生产的工作却更加的复杂化了。

一台计算机总共有超过15000个不同的零部件,并且每一个零部件又是由若干个元件组成,又由于IBM公司的工厂在美国各地都有遍及,而不同的定货又需要不同的元件和不同的部件,所以产品上必须注明某工厂的某设备生产某元件,由此产生了不仅在生产复杂,运输、安装以及装配也都十分复杂。

所以需要有一个生产状态报告系统,这个系统是以计算机控制为基础的。

来保证在其他环节以及生产都能顺利进行。

所以在同一年IBM公司开发出来了一个系统即先进管理系统AAS,这一系统能做到450个业务操作。

在1968年,公司又陆续突出了公用制造信息系统CMIS,运行也很成功,该系统用3周的时间就可以完成过去需要15周的工作任务[2]。

第三阶段即状态报告系统,这个系统还有另外一种表现形式是数据处理系统。

数据处理系统是用来处理生产报告和日常业务,但是重点在于能够将手工作业转变为自动化,节省人力和提高效率,但同时这一系统在一般情况下是不能提供决策信息的。

最后的阶段是决策支持系统,这一系统是用来帮助决策的信

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 经管营销 > 经济市场

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1